I was talking to one of my GM friends and he said this is one if the worst job markets he’s ever seen for managers but even for all levels in the restaurant industry. I’m really scared about losing my job even though I think I’m safe. My friends just got let go at different restaurants. Is it really as bad as I think or am I imagining things?

The job market is still on life support because of the Trump terrifs in Toronto Ontario. If you have a job, keep it and continue to look for greater opportunities in sectors that you aren't employed in, but your skills would transfer easily.

like

Yep - life support is the right way to put it. It really is horrible out there.

From what everyone seems to be saying, yeah, it's pretty bad. Anyone who has a job should try to hang on to it. People looking for work are complaining that no one is hiring. Every news story about the economy talks about how uncertain everything is, and that's the whole story. Establishments are just hesitant to hire anyone with the economy sliding downward.

Check the overtime laws for your state!!

I just recently worked 58.6 hours in a week, weekly pay, nice OT profit right? Depends on where you live.

In Iowa, there is no Overtime pay mandate, the overtime pay is at the discretion of the business. I received 58.6 hours of base pay for the week.

If the company makes less than $1 million per year or does not engage in intercontinental sales, the company is not required to pay the overtime rate of time and a half, just your base rate.
